IP QoS原理与实现:拥塞管理策略解析
需积分: 9 158 浏览量
更新于2024-08-14
收藏 1.13MB PPT 举报
"拥塞管理续-QOS原理及实现"
在IP网络中,服务质量(QoS,Quality of Service)是确保关键业务流量得到适当处理的重要机制。QoS的主要目的是解决网络带宽、延迟、抖动和丢包等问题,以优化网络性能,特别是对于实时和关键业务的通信。
1. QoS基本概念
QoS是一系列技术的集合,用于在网络中对不同类型的流量进行区分和优先级控制,以保证关键业务的稳定性和高效性。QoS通常涉及报文的分类、标记、流量整形、拥塞管理以及拥塞避免等方面。
2. 报文的分类和标记
报文分类是将网络流量分为不同类别,以便进行差异化处理。例如,WFQ(Weighted Fair Queuing)利用HASH算法对报文进行分类,并分配到不同的队列,根据优先级分配带宽。CBQ(Class-Based Queuing)进一步扩展了WFQ,允许用户自定义服务类别,如EF(Expedited Forwarding)的低延迟队列(LLQ)、AF(Assured Forwarding)的宽带队列(BQ)以及默认类别的WFQ服务。分类依据可以是IP优先级、DSCP(Differentiated Services Code Point)、输入接口或IP报文的五元组(源IP、目的IP、源端口、目的端口、协议)。
3. 流量整形与监管
流量整形(Traffic Shaping)是限制发送速率,确保其不超过预先设定的上限,避免产生拥塞。监管(Traffic Policing)则是设定流量的上限并严格执行,超过限制的报文会被丢弃或标记。这两者结合使用,可以有效管理网络资源,防止拥塞的发生。
4. 拥塞管理与避免
拥塞管理是当网络出现拥塞时,如何公平地处理流量。WFQ和CBQ是两种常用的队列管理策略,前者通过动态调整队列权重分配带宽,后者根据预定义的服务类别分配带宽。拥塞避免则是在拥塞发生前采取措施,如使用随机早期检测(RED)或尾丢弃(Tail-Drop)策略,减少突发流量对网络稳定性的影响。
5. QoS应用实例
QoS的应用广泛,如VoIP(Voice over IP)和视频会议,需要低延迟和低抖动,因此通常使用EF类服务。对于FTP、HTTP等一般数据传输,可以使用AF类服务,保证一定的传输速率但允许一定丢包。默认类别的WFQ服务则适用于未明确指定QoS策略的其他流量。
QoS通过精细控制网络资源,确保了各种业务的性能需求,从而提高了网络的效率和用户满意度。理解并合理应用QoS策略是网络管理员优化网络性能的关键。华为3Com的QoS解决方案提供了一套完整的工具和技术,帮助网络管理者应对各种网络挑战。
2023-09-13 上传
2009-02-24 上传
2008-06-27 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
2021-05-02 上传
2009-11-13 上传
2018-05-29 上传
昨夜星辰若似我
- 粉丝: 48
- 资源: 2万+
最新资源
- 前端协作项目:发布猜图游戏功能与待修复事项
- Spring框架REST服务开发实践指南
- ALU课设实现基础与高级运算功能
- 深入了解STK:C++音频信号处理综合工具套件
- 华中科技大学电信学院软件无线电实验资料汇总
- CGSN数据解析与集成验证工具集:Python和Shell脚本
- Java实现的远程视频会议系统开发教程
- Change-OEM: 用Java修改Windows OEM信息与Logo
- cmnd:文本到远程API的桥接平台开发
- 解决BIOS刷写错误28:PRR.exe的应用与效果
- 深度学习对抗攻击库:adversarial_robustness_toolbox 1.10.0
- Win7系统CP2102驱动下载与安装指南
- 深入理解Java中的函数式编程技巧
- GY-906 MLX90614ESF传感器模块温度采集应用资料
- Adversarial Robustness Toolbox 1.15.1 工具包安装教程
- GNU Radio的供应商中立SDR开发包:gr-sdr介绍